Checkrack

/ˈtʃɛkˌræk/ noun

Definition

A rack or frame specifically designed to hold or organize items that need to be checked, verified, or processed.

Etymology

From 'check' (to verify) and 'rack' (a framework for holding items). This compound term is primarily used in specialized contexts like manufacturing, restaurants, or institutional settings.
